Pulse Tracker Checker Analyzer is a health-tracking app for iOS that uses optical camera sensors to monitor heart rate and log blood pressure.

What makes this app unique?
Users open Pulse Tracker Checker Analyzer to establish daily cardiovascular baselines without the cost or complexity of external medical hardware.
For Fitness-focused individuals and users monitoring cardiovascular wellness who prefer smartphone-based tracking over external hardware.
What does it look like?
Key features
Uses smartphone camera and flash to detect pulse via fingertip contact.
Manual entry system for systolic and diastolic readings with note-taking capability.
Dashboard displays historical heart rate and blood pressure data through charts.
How much does it cost?
Subscription model anchored by auto-renewing payments managed through iTunes account settings.

Pulse Tracker Checker Analyzer is currently in a maintenance phase, with only one release recorded in the analyzed window. The latest version, released 113 days ago, focused exclusively on minor bug fixes and platform optimization. There is no evidence of new feature development or live operations, indicating a stable but stagnant development cycle. Future updates remain infrequent, consistent with a long-term maintenance strategy.
